JTA is a Japanese airline that was founded in 1967 as Southwest Air Lines. It adopted its present name in 1993. Today, the airline is majority owned by Japan Airlines and as such provides domestic services on behalf of Japan Airlines. Ti is based at Naha, Okinawa and operates to around 15 destinations with its fleet of Boeing B737-800 aircraft.

Check in rules

Japan Transocean Air Online Check-in is available for both domestic and international flights. Passengers can finish check-in by any of the below options: mobile check-in (App check-in), online check-in, and airport check-in. Japan Transocean Air online Check-in opens 24 hours and closes 2 hours before scheduled flight departure time.

Baggage

Japan Transocean Air Carry-on Baggage Allowance: it may not exceed 55cm × 40cm × 25cm=115cm in size and 10 kg in weight. Japan Transocean Air Checked and Excess Baggage Allowance: up to 20kg is free of charge for each passenger; up to 45kg is free of charge for First Class passengers; total dimension of checked baggage is 50cm x 60cm x 120cm; for items exceeding the free allowance while within a total weight of 100kg (maximum to 32kg per item), you may check them in with an Excess Baggage Charge; total weight must not exceed 45kg.

Unaccompanied minors

The airline provides a service of escorting minors. Airline allows children over six years old to travel alone. The airline allows children over the age of six to travel alone. For children aged 6-7 years old, an escort service is mandatory. For children 7-11 years old the service is available upon request.

Infants

Passengers accompanying children under 3 years of age (8 days and older) cannot occupy emergency exit seats for safety reasons. If you are traveling with 2 children under 3 years of age (8 days and older) and would like to sit next to each other, choose a priority seat for "guests with 2 infants".
